Practical Use: Testing Good Vibes in Different Projects
When working with small hoop sizes, the Good Vibes design requires careful planning. The design is not overly large, so it can be easily split into sections if needed. However, some areas feature tiny lettering or detailed elements that may require extra attention during stitching.
On dark fabrics, the thread color contrast is crucial. Using light-colored threads, such as white or pastel shades, ensures the design stands out. For lighter fabrics, a darker thread color can provide better visibility and depth.
Stitch density is another important factor. While the design isn’t overly dense, certain areas—like the background fill—may need additional stabilizer to prevent puckering or distortion. This is especially true when working with stretchy or delicate materials.

Design Notes for Success
To get the best results with Good Vibes, always test the embroidery file on scrap fabric before using it on a final project. This helps identify any issues with stitch density, thread color contrast, or stabilizer needs. Checking the design on both light and dark fabrics ensures it will look good in all applications.
Proper hoop size is essential for maintaining the integrity of the design. If the design is too large for your hoop, consider splitting it into smaller sections. This approach also helps with complex areas that may require more precise stitching.
